Hi, I am building a site cum software using codeignier. In this i want to have a layer between controllers and models like services. So that i can use PHPUnit and other APIs in it. Basically the purpose of this layer is that not direct communication between controllers and models. Controllers communicates with service layer and service layer communicate with database(models). Can this scenario be implemented via codeigniter as i need it for my project. I know the flexibility of codeigniter framework. [eluser]jmadsen[/eluser]
CodeIgniter is php If you can do it in php, you can do it in CodeIgniter. I often will use libraries in a way similar to what he seems to be describing in the article. Controllers call a library with the business logic & multiple model function calls inside a "wrapper" function |
